    Oil Pump problem?

    I think the oil pump on my 2006 VF-2SS is not working. I didn't see any alarms, but I notice my coolant is not longer being covered with tramp oil. I like not having to run the not too effective oil skimmer, but I kind of wonder why? The manual plunger only has about ~1" of travel and doesn't go all the way down, Is that normal? Oil pressure gauge shows pressure when I manually raise the plunger.

    Can I open up the way cover to check on the ball screw? Do I loosen the way cover screws near the table or near the axis ends?

    If your gage is showing pressure, the pump is likely working. There are several bronze filter elements inline with the lube oil that become plugged, most often resulting from the use of low-grade way lube. Low-quality way lubes contain waxes such as beeswax and/or carnauba wax which restrict or completely plug these fine filter elements. You can change these filters on your own for a relatively cheap cost. Check your parts manual for the number of elements and replace them all.

    Replacing the filters will be really finicky, even taking off the way covers is finicky. If you have been using the oil Haas recomends it is not likely anything is blocked. Also based on my experience it is not likely the pump has failed. You can do a test with the manual pump. Pull it up and when you release it the pressure gauge should show pressure (I forget how much). This should drop to zero in more than ten minutes but less than thirty minutes. If it drops quickly there is probably a leak somewhere. If it drops very slowly then something is blocked.

    You should also look at the oil level. If it has not dropped then aomething is probably wrong. Also look at the waste oil bottle, if this is empty then way oil is not getting through.
